Cannot close oven door after cleaning
Hi Pauline:
Lots of oven doors are mounted by metal tabs that slide into slots.
I'd guess that maybe while cleaning, they may have moved.
Try moving the door towards the closed position until it binds or stops. Stand facing the door, knees against it, and hold both edges of the door with your hands. Gently lift the door and then try to slide it back down toward the hinge point. If it does not want to move, use a flashlight and try to determine what is stopping it from closing.
Hope this helps. Let me know.
Westinghouse side by side refrigerator, model WSE6100WA fridge not working and electronic display is blank,
If the electronic display is blank and the fridge is not working, it is possible that there is an issue with the power supply to the fridge or with the control board. Here are some steps that you can take to troubleshoot the issue:
- Check the power supply: Make sure that the fridge is properly plugged in and that the circuit breaker hasn't tripped.
- Check the control board: The control board is responsible for regulating the temperature in the fridge and freezer. If the control board is faulty, it may cause the electronic display to be blank and the fridge to stop working. Try resetting the control board by unplugging the fridge for a few minutes and plugging it back in.
- Check the temperature sensors: The temperature sensors in the fridge and freezer are responsible for communicating the temperature to the control board. If a sensor is faulty, it may cause the fridge to stop working. You may need to replace the faulty sensor.
- Call a professional: If you're not comfortable troubleshooting the issue on your own, it's best to call a professional appliance repair technician to diagnose and fix the problem.
It's important to address this issue as soon as possible to prevent food from spoiling in the fridge and freezer.

Westinghouse wse6100sa side by side fridge. Freezer not cold enough
Check to see that the fridge is level and the doors are properly aligned and closing properly.
If the door hinges are not set properly, the door will not close properly and there will be an air leak around the seals.
If this happens, the fridge will run continuously and all the stuff in your vegetable bin will keep freezing
